Adding Unlike denominators 1/11 + 1/4

Respuesta :

telenafalls
telenafalls telenafalls
  • 11-10-2021

Answer: 15/44

Step-by-step explanation:

You have to make the denominators match so:

1/11(4) + 1/4(11)=

4/44 + 11/44=

15/44
